Output 5c722976179c21ef360d7964d01b202e30fc132cb3e9a783e0ba9df7d88fe465:1

value
2331
script pubkey
OP_0 OP_PUSHBYTES_20 81e73f59993f4cf0fa0e7a73acccd2defff339b2
address
bc1qs8nn7kve8ax0p7sw0fe6enxjmmllxwdjmqt2hd
transaction
5c722976179c21ef360d7964d01b202e30fc132cb3e9a783e0ba9df7d88fe465
confirmations
392291
spent
true